ABSTRACT

Purpose: To investigate the role and mechanism of ß1,3-N-acetylglucosaminyltransferase-3 gene (B3GNT3) in esophageal cancer (ESCA). Methods: The starBase database was used to evaluate the expression of B3GNT3. B3GNT3 function was measured using KYSE-30 and KYSE-410 cells of esophageal squamous cell carcinoma (ESCC) cell lines. The mRNA levels were detected by quantitative real-time polymerase chain reaction (qRT-PCR). Cell counting kit-8, clone formation assay and transwell assay were used to detect the changes of proliferation, invasion and migration. Results: B3GNT3 expression was higher in ESCA tissues than in normal tissues. The overall survival rate of ESCA patients with high B3GNT3 expression was lower than that of ESCA patients with low B3GNT3 expression. In vitro functional experiments showed that the proliferation ability, migration and invasion ability of KYSE-30 and KYSE-410 cells with B3GNT3 interference were lower than those of the control, and the overexpression of B3GNT3 had the opposite effect. After silencing B3GNT3 expression in ESCC cell lines, the growth of both cell lines was inhibited and the invasiveness was decreased. Knockdown of B3GNT3 reduced the growth rate and Ki-67 expression level. Conclusion: B3GNT3, as an oncogene, may promote the growth, invasion and migration of ESCC cell.

ABSTRACT

@#Objective To explore the possible factors which influence the survival time of elderly patients with esophageal cancer. Methods We retrospectively analyzed the data of patients with esophageal cancer treated in the First Hospital of Lanzhou University, Gansu Province Tumor Hospital from January 2012 to October 2016. Kaplan-Meier method was used to estimate and analyze the single factor, survival curve with log-rank test. The Cox regression model was used for multivariate prognostic analysis. Results According to the inclusion and exclusion criteria, 302 patients were eventually collected, including 231 males and 71 females, with an average age of 66.0±6.0 years. The univariate analysis showed that age, tumor stage, tumor site, Karnosfsky performance satus (KPS) score, and treatment were prognostic factors (P<0.05). Multivariate analysis showed that the patient age and treatment were independent factors for overall survival (OS) and progress-free survival (PFS) (P<0.05). The OS and PFS of the patients with age≤70 years were better than those of the patients more than 70 years. Chemotherapy alone and surgery alone was better for survival situation than radiotherapy alone. Conclusion Age and treatment are independent prognostic factors in survival time of the elderly patients with esophageal cancer.

ABSTRACT

@#Objective    To evaluate the effect of fast track surgery (FTS) after esophageal cancer surgery. Methods    The randomized controlled trial (RCT) and observational studies about FTS for esophageal cancer in PubMed、EMbase、The Cochrane Library、Web of Science、CBM、CNKI and WanFang databases were searched up to May 2017. Then the studies were screened according to the inclusion and exclusion criteria by two researchers. Data were analyzed by Stata12.0 software. Results     Totally 13 RCTs and 5 observational studies with 2 447 patients were eligible for analysis. Compared with the control group, incidence of postoperative complications (OR=0.53, 95%CI 0.40 to 0.71, P<0.05) significantly reduced in the FTS group, but there was no significant difference between the two groups in readmission rate (OR=1.21, 95%CI 0.83 to 1.76, P=0.313) and 30 d mortality rate (OR=0.72, 95%CI 0.43 to 1.20, P=0.207). Conclusion    FTS can safely and effectively accelerate the recovery of patients with esophageal cancer and it owns important clinical values.
